Peter Stamp has been full Professor of Crop Production and Plant Breeding (today Agronomy and Plant Breeding) in the Institute of Plant Science at the ETH Zurich since September 1, 1988. He is primarily engaged in the fundamentals of environmentally friendly cultivation systems.
Prof. Stamp was born on August 20, 1945 in Schleswig, Germany. He studied and completed his doctorate and his habilitation at the Christian Albrecht University in Kiel.
He was appointed professor of plant cultivation at the University Kassel on 1 April 1985 and Professor Ordinarius of Crop Production and Plant Breeding at the ETH Zurich on 1 April 1988. His research focuses on plant cultivation for environmentally friendly cultivation systems, including root development and stress resistance as well as the analysis of androgenetic fundamentals. This research is generally carried out in interdisciplinary programs at national and international levels.
In view of the precarious situation of feeding the world population in the future, such relevant topics are coordinated in the framework of international agricultural projects.
